WebFeb 9, 2024 · The Census recognizes six different racial and ethnic categories: White American, Native American and Alaska Native, Asian American, Black or African … kubectl context commandsWebThe first ethnic branches in the Victorian ALP were formed in Northcote in 1975, representing the two largest non-Anglo ethnic groups living in the municipality. To ensure respectability by minimising opposition to their formation, locality names were used for the two branches-Croxton (Italian) and Westgarth (Greek). kubectl context 切り替えWebCushitic-speaking peoples. Cushitic-speaking peoples are the ethnolinguistic groups who speak Cushitic languages natively. Today, Cushitic languages are spoken primarily in the Horn of Africa, with minorities speaking Cushitic languages to the north and south in Egypt, the Sudan, Kenya, and Tanzania. kubectl config use-context internalWebWhen an ethnic group of relativity new arrivals has been completely integrated into the economic and cultural mainstream of a society that group is said to have been … kubectl config unsetWebethnic branches and speak Afan Oromo (Oromo language), one of the most widely spoken languages in Ethiopia.
